Electronic licences for export control ELIC
Elic is an electronic licensing system for the submission and processing of applications relating to industrial products (Goods Control Act) and war materiel (War Materiel Act).

Login with AGOV (replacing CH-Login)
AGOV is Switzerland's official government login, offering enhanced security and improved user-friendliness. It can be used for a wide range of online services provided by the Confederation, cantons and communes. Tips, explanatory videos, FAQs and guidance on using AGOV are available at AGOV help — agov.ch.

Internal Compliance Programme – ICP
Legal entities must demonstrate the existence of a reliable internal control system – known in technical parlance as an Internal Compliance Programme (ICP) – in order to obtain a licence under the war materiel legislation. (Art. 12a para. 2 WMO; Art. 5 para. 2 GCO)
When opening an Elic account, the ICP verification document is automatically included in the registration process and stored in the company's account. Any changes made after the account has been opened must be submitted to SECO electronically as a new ICP: info.elic@seco.admin.ch. The form can be found under ‘ICP Verification’.
